Annual CO₂ emissions from gas in Bolivia
Bolivia: Annual CO₂ emissions from gas was 12.41 million tonnes in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Annual CO₂ emissions from gas in Bolivia, 1928–2024
Source: Global Carbon Budget (2025) – with major processing by Our World in Data. Measured in tonnes.
Analysis
In 2024, annual co₂ emissions from gas in Bolivia stood at 12.41 million tonnes. That is the highest value across all 97 years on record.
That represents a change of up 38.5% on the previous year and up 63.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, annual co₂ emissions from gas in Bolivia peaked at 12.41 million tonnes in 2024 and was at its lowest, 0 tonnes, in 1928.
Bolivia ranks 57th of 146 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1920s | 0 tonnes | 0 tonnes | 0 tonnes | 2 |
| 1930s | 0 tonnes | 0 tonnes | 0 tonnes | 10 |
| 1940s | 0 tonnes | 0 tonnes | 0 tonnes | 10 |
| 1950s | 5,856 tonnes | 0 tonnes | 14,603 tonnes | 10 |
| 1960s | 104,737 tonnes | 10,992 tonnes | 190,254 tonnes | 10 |
| 1970s | 284,690 tonnes | 62,288 tonnes | 678,365 tonnes | 10 |
| 1980s | 602,295 tonnes | 421,360 tonnes | 864,704 tonnes | 10 |
| 1990s | 2.48 million tonnes | 1.44 million tonnes | 3.74 million tonnes | 10 |
| 2000s | 3.99 million tonnes | 2.41 million tonnes | 4.99 million tonnes | 10 |
| 2010s | 7.47 million tonnes | 5.68 million tonnes | 8.70 million tonnes | 10 |
| 2020s | 8.72 million tonnes | 6.61 million tonnes | 12.41 million tonnes | 5 |
